Montreal Breaks Ground on Eco-Initiative
In a bid to tackle the growing concern of wasted energy, one Montreal warehouse has come up with a sustainable solution that resonates with those interested in construction and real estate developments. Leveraging their industrial heat waste, the warehouse has designed and implemented a novel geothermal heating system that serves neighbouring buildings. This vast leap in energy conservation is not only reducing their carbon footprint but also decreasing their operating costs, providing double benefits.
Harnessing Heat to Power Much More than Industry
This innovative project sees the surplus heat generated by the warehouse converted into energy which is then funnelled to surrounding buildings. During summer, the energy is used to power air conditioning units. In colder months, it is repurposed to aid in heating.
